Tone & Electronics
At 6.8K DC ohms with 3 henries of inductance and a Q factor of 3.1, this pickup produces the focused, slightly compressed response characteristic of early Jaguar bridge units. The hand-ground Alnico 5 rod magnets paired with heavy formvar magnet wire deliver articulate highs and controlled lows without excessive brightness, making it equally effective for surf textures and rhythm tracking.
Construction & Specification
Every element reflects vintage Jaguar orthodoxy: vintage-correct bottom gray flatwork, cloth push-back lead wire, and lacquered and wax potting for durability. The raised top and bottom magnet pattern with south polarity ensures proper interaction with matched neck pickups, while into-body height adjustment allows fine-tuning of output balance within your mix.
Key Features
- Hand-ground Alnico 5 rod magnets
- Custom coil wind with heavy formvar magnet wire
- DC Ohms: 6.8K
- Inductance: 3 henries
- Q Factor: 3.1
- Vintage-correct bottom gray flatwork and cloth push-back lead wire
- Lacquered and wax potted for reliability
- Raised top and bottom magnet pattern
- South polarity (bridge position)
- Into-body height adjustment
- Factory calibrated
- Top length: 2.630" / width: 0.612"
- Bottom length: 3.285" / width: 0.612"
- Total height: 0.605" / magnet height: 0.688"
